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58 7980403 00721588733 372 9845190913
5491 6524773094 88654179322
5491 6524773094 88654179322
375924 45 35 87252289309
All about undefined
Interested in learning more?
5491 6524773094 88654179322
375924 45 35 87252289309
See more
493 01284376831 7147840
747314 66 708337 7519
See more
766 0828734
11810 59 4461 9061
See more